Children of the drug war [electronic resource] : perspectives on the impact of drug policies on young people / Damon Barrett, editor. New York, N.Y. : International Debate Education Association, 2011. x, 241 p. : ill. Includes bibliographical references. Frontlines: production and trade -- Real life on the frontlines of Colombia's drug war / Jess Hunter-Bowman -- Children : forgotten victims in Mexico's drug war / Aram Barra & Daniel Joloy -- In the shadows of the insurgency in Afghanistan : child bartering, opium debt, and the war on drugs / Christopher Kuonqui & Atal Ahmadzai -- After the war on drugs : how legal regulation of production and trade would better protect children / Steve Rolles -- Targets : race, class, and law enforcement -- Getting the message : hip hop reports on the drug war / Deborah Peterson Small -- Under cover of privilege : college drug dealing in the United States / A. Rafik Mohamed & Erik Fritsvold -- Young soldiers in Brazil's drug war / Michelle Gueraldi -- Home front : the impact on families -- Dancing with despair : a mother's perspective / Gretchen Burns Bergman -- Mothers and children of the drug war : a view from a women's prison in Quito, Ecuador / Jennifer Fleetwood & Andreina Torres -- Between Diego and Mario : children of the drug war in Indonesia / Asmin Fransiska, Ricky Gunawan & Ajeng Larasati -- "Ants facing an elephant" : mothers' grief, loss, and work for change following the placement of children in the care of child protection services / Kathleen Kenny & Amy Druker -- Justification : children, drug use, and dependence -- Youth drug use research and the missing pieces in the puzzle : how can researchers support the next generation of harm reduction approaches? / Catherine Cook & Adam Fletcher -- Taking drugs together : early adult transitions and the limits of harm reduction in England and Wales / Michael Shiner -- Drug testing in schools : a case study in doing more harm than good / Adam Fletcher -- Dependence on drugs and alcohol for survival : a case study on young people and street children in Badagry, a border town in Nigeria / Femi Aina Fasinu -- "I've been waiting for this my whole life" : life transitions and heroin use / Jovana Arsenijevic & Andjelka Nikolic -- Why should children suffer? : palliative care and pain management for children / Joan Marston.
